The seven species of owls that nest in Massachusetts are listed below beginning with those that are the most conspicuous, common, or widespread. Check the following links for more information about each species, including their geographical distribution, preferred habitats, and what they look like and sound like*.


Follow the links below to help identify your owl.
 
Great Horned      listen    ||    see photo    ||    read more 
Barred      listen    ||    see photo    ||    read more 
Eastern Screech      listen    ||    see photo    ||    read more 
Northern Saw-whet      listen    ||    see photo    ||    read more 
Long-eared      listen    ||    see photo    ||    read more 
Barn      listen    ||    see photo    ||    read more 
Short-eared      listen    ||    see photo    ||    read more
